Discover More About Full map of spain | Find Details On Full map of spain
SponsoredInfo on Full map of spain. Trusted Articles and Content. Gain insight and knowledg…Site visitors: Over 100K in the past monthInformative Content · Trusted Information · Quality Content · Curated Topics
Full map of spain – Start Reading | Learn More
SponsoredInfo on Full map of spain. Trusted Articles and Content. Gain insight and knowledg…Site visitors: Over 100K in the past monthConcise Explanations · Trusted Information · Informative Content · Curated Topics

Feedback